Purpose - The aim of exploratory study is to increase the understanding of the effects digitalization has on the tools and working methods of the audit profession. Methodology - Websites of 235 audit firms authorized by POA (Public Oversight, Accounting and Auditing Standards Authority) were examined. In addition, transparency reports of 64 companies authorized for Public Interest Entity (PIE) Audit were investigated as well. The status of the services provided by the audit companies after the technological developments were analyzed. In addition, infrastructure and continuous education investments of audit firms related to digitalization have been determined. Findings- It has been found that almost all audit companies provide services for independent audit and tax audit. (Respectively 95% and 85%). These are followed by financial services and internal audit issues. (Respectively 61% and 45%). Only Big Four invest the necessary infrastructure and human resources in addition to providing services in these matters. In spite of all these technological developments, only 24 companies provide education to their employees for IT / IT audits. Only Big Four provide education for digital technologies to their employees. Conclusion- As a result, with the effect of digitalization, Information technologies have gained importance. But the audit firms have not yet made the necessary investment in these areas. 90% of audit firms do not provide services in these areas and do not make infrastructure and human resources investments.
